Ather's Head of Manufacturing, Sanjeev Kumar took us through the new capacity which can make around 4.20 lakh EV scooters per annum. While the present capacity utilisation is 50%, the co. plans to use the full capacity by the end of this financial year.

Also a single vehicle after complete assembly goes through a min lf 4 tests like speed test, on road test, dyno test etc. Apart from this the product goes through unique monitoring at each phase. Why? So the defect rate is super low. For Ather it is at the industry low of 0.5%

Why are SaaS firms at high risk? Almost 80-90% of all the SaaS firm's biz are from The US, the UK, and a very small portion from India. Now in a recession environment, the SaaS firms' customers (esp SMBs) will turn judicious, cut down costs, and may not spend on software.
